You are not logged in.

#1 2026-04-09 04:17:13

archelvetic
Member
Registered: 2017-10-26
Posts: 45

gcc test-suite takes over 24h on every update

I'm having quite the same iusse as described here[0].

Alas I have no idea how to disable tests by reading the manpage of makepkg.conf. Grepping the manpage for 'test' returns nil.

So how can I disable those tests entirely?

[0] https://bbs.archlinux.org/viewtopic.php?id=264181

Offline

#2 2026-04-09 04:39:30

dimich
Member
From: Kharkiv, Ukraine
Registered: 2009-11-03
Posts: 577

Re: gcc test-suite takes over 24h on every update

archelvetic wrote:

So how can I disable those tests entirely?

Do you mean check() function in PKGBUILD?

man 5 makepkg.conf:

BUILDENV=(!distcc !color !ccache check !sign)
...
check
Run the check() function if present in the PKGBUILD. This can be enabled or disabled for individual packages through the use of makepkg’s --check and --nocheck options, respectively.

Offline

#3 2026-04-09 05:18:06

Allan
Pacman
From: Brisbane, AU
Registered: 2007-06-09
Posts: 11,672
Website

Re: gcc test-suite takes over 24h on every update

I highly recommend you build those test even if they take a long time.  Or at least keep the old version around.  Having a broken compiler prevents building a new compiler!

Offline

#4 2026-04-09 08:02:18

seth
Member
From: Won't reply 2 private help req
Registered: 2012-09-03
Posts: 74,655

Re: gcc test-suite takes over 24h on every update

… or ends up building broken binaries that crash for weird reasons you don't understand.
("Fixing" gcc is actually easy by installing the repo version)

Online

#5 2026-04-09 08:42:51

archelvetic
Member
Registered: 2017-10-26
Posts: 45

Re: gcc test-suite takes over 24h on every update

Ok, got the message :-)

Offline

Board footer

Powered by FluxBB